ISLA Instruments founder, Brad Holland has been obsessed with drum machines for many years. Owning, repairing, restoring, modifying countless makes and models. The SP-2400 is nothing short of a passion project. Along with a small team of talented Software Engineers, CAD Engineers and revered artists, they have developed what they think is a future classic.
Staying true to form in both sonic characteristics and design aesthetic were the main drivers in the realisation of this project, while bringing the hardware into the 21st Century and keeping the same ‘instant gratification’ and intuitiveness of its spiritual pre-predecessor at heart.
Features
- Sturdy 4-piece Steel/Aluminium enclosure.
- Mains Powered 100-250V AC.
- Dual Audio Engine: 12-Bit/26.04khz Lo-Fi Engine (Classic SP Sound) and 24-Bit/48khz Hi-Fi Engine
- Stereo Recording/Playback.
- Channels 1-8 Pannable to Main out L/R Channels 7+8 can be ‘linked’ to support stereo audio content.
- Headphone Output (9-10) w/independant monitoring of channels.
- Dedicated Microphone Pre-Amp.
- Looper Pedal Mode (with full duplex recording/playback).
- Record and overdub live audio during playback.
- USB Host & Device Ports: Connect usb thumb drives, keyboards, midi controllers directly into the SP2400.
